Tarique Rahman expresses concern over Shahjalal Airport fire

Bangladesh Nationalist Party (BNP) Acting Chairman Tarique Rahman has expressed deep concern over the fire incident at the cargo complex of Hazrat Shahjalal International Airport in Dhaka.

In a statement on Saturday (October 18, 2025), he said, “I am deeply concerned about the fire incident at the airport’s cargo complex. My condolences and prayers go out to all those affected, and I sincerely hope everyone is safe.”

Tarique Rahman expressed gratitude to the fire service, armed forces and all the rescue workers involved for bravely taking part in quickly bringing the fire under control. He said, “Their quick action and bravery reflect a true commitment to public service.”

He also said that the incidents of fire have increased at an alarming rate in recent times. He demanded a full and transparent investigation into the series of accidents, including the fire at a factory in the Chittagong Export Processing Zone (EPZ) and the fire at a garment factory in Mirpur.

Tarique Rahman stressed, “A full and transparent investigation is essential to uncover the real causes of these incidents and strengthen public safety in the future.”
